This free technique guide will help you learn to sew 1/2" double fold bias tape.
Be sure to download "How to Make 1/2" Double Fold Bias Tape" technique guide. You'll be able to both make and sew your own bias/binding tape!
When I sew bia/binding tape, I use a stiletto or scissors with a curved blade to hold my binding in place. Check out my blog to learn more about using an edge stitch foot. It really helps with this technique.
